Impossible
Парни, кто юзает корутины, киньте +
Alexey 🇪🇸
Корутины* +
Impossible
Вот и думаю, стоит ли на них перейти с rx
Anonymous
https://pastebin.com/CwEa624V
Impossible
Корутины* +
только 1, админ, юзает ?)
Alexey 🇪🇸
https://pastebin.com/CwEa624V
эм, а где у тебя startActivity ?
Max
https://pastebin.com/CwEa624V
а кто делать startActivity будет?
Alexey 🇪🇸
телепат детектед
Anonymous
Да пропустил , спасибо 😀
Alexey 🇪🇸
💪
в след раз сразу Оганнеса тригери без кода, теперь он главный телепат чат 😏
Андрей
если я задам вопрос, угадаешь что это было?
Андрей
короче ладно, вдруг кто встречал
Андрей
Есть снекбар, на эмуляторе работает нормально, на чистом андроиде нормально, на xiami и samsung задержка не работает, т.е. просто игнорится и снекбар показывается пол секунды
Андрей
соственно код: val snackbar = Snackbar.make(view, text, 3000) snackbar.view.setBackgroundColor(ContextCompat.getColor(view.context, R.color.accent_color)) snackbar.show()
D
соственно код: val snackbar = Snackbar.make(view, text, 3000) snackbar.view.setBackgroundColor(ContextCompat.getColor(view.context, R.color.accent_color)) snackbar.show()
А если вместо 3000 подставить LENGTH_LONG или другую стандартную константу?
Андрей
более того я ковырял исходники - LENGTH_LONG это 2750
D
Хм
Андрей
Хм
глубже копать надо)
Андрей
D
Окок
Андрей
D
ну 3000мс же
А,в смысле не задержка, а время отображения
D
Понял
Андрей
ну да
Vadim
Кто-нибудь пользуется медиумом? Я написал статью по интеграции in-app. Может кому-то будет полезно, и похлопайте, пожалуйста, кому не трудно:)) https://medium.com/chili-labs/tutorial-google-play-billing-in-app-purchases-6143bda8d290
Андрей
что не так?
Anonymous
Задача такая : делать запрос(vk api) каждые 30 секунд. Вопрос как это сделать с помощью цикла и таймера или есть какие то другие способы?
VӨVΛ
Вечер добрый, помогите разобрать почему так выходит. Нету отступа, хотя я его указывал
VӨVΛ
вот картинка с компонентами
VӨVΛ
Понял, в чем проблема. Программно меняю background, из за этого пропадает отступ снизу, почему это происходит?
uvays
покажи xml
Семен
Зарылся с SearchView не понимаю почему в методе onCreateOptionsMenu(), строка, которую достаю из`Bundle` зануляется? Если кто-то сможет посмотрите. https://github.com/AsiAsiAsiA/RecyclerViewDiffUtils
VӨVΛ
покажи xml
https://pastebin.com/DKrzcczs
Dmytro
думаю, ответ кроется в 9patch
подумал, что padding пропадает 🤦‍♂️ сорян
Eugene
Доброй ночи! Только познакомился с корутинами котлин и хочу попробовать реализовать progressDialog на UI потоке и загрузку данных в фоне. Кто имеет опыт с корутин, посмотрите пожалуйста, это адекватное решение?
Eugene
Eugene
Я просто не понимаю пока, как это можно иначе сделать
Eugene
Что бы на UI крутилась загрузка, а на фоне шла подгрузка из бд
Dmytro
https://proandroiddev.com/kotlin-coroutines-patterns-anti-patterns-f9d12984c68e не эксперт, но думаю как-то так будет лучше GlobalScope.launch(Dispatcher.Main) { view.showLoading() withContext(Dispatcher.IO) { /* do smth */ } view.hideLoading() }
Eugene
Да уж, и в эти моменты понимаешь насколько ты еще на поверхности :)
Eugene
Спасибо;)
Anonymous
Всем привет! Какая разница что использовать: navbarRelativeLayout.setGravity(Gravity.BOTTOM); или navbarRelativeLayout.setGravity(BOTTOM); Все работает одинаково идеально. Я как понял, что без разницы, да? Спасибо.
Anonymous
нажми ctrl+b на каждый из них и просто сравни значения
Я знаю, но вот разница есть как использовать?
Андрей
Я знаю, но вот разница есть как использовать?
блин если у них одно и то же значение - нет разницы, если значения разные, то очевидно, что и разница есть
Андрей
🤔
ну если конечно ты не думаешь что в разных версиях андроида их значение может быть различным
Андрей
причем говоря о разных версиях оемовское говно я тоже имею ввиду)
Богдан
Кто знает, как сделать что бы приложение запускалось например после 3-x нажатий на кнопку power в телефоне?
Андрей
но как я и думал - единственный вариант это все время держать запущенным сервис-интерсептор
Pavel
Всем привет. Посоветуйте решение для просмотра изображений в приложении. Желательно с поддержкой зумирования и жестов. Изображения подгружаются из сети с помощью Glide. Или придется писать свое?
Pavel
Для понимания лучше свое написать, на гите много примеров валяется
Можете дать ссылку на пример, который вам больше всего нравится?
Pavel
Свое написанно. Но просто проект сейчас в такой стадии, что нужно побыстрее добавить функционал и в продакшн.
Pavel
Пока реализованно зумирование и литсание на основе ViewPager
Pavel
Просто если нет, то отложу до следующей итерации :)
Aleksandr
https://github.com/chrisbanes/PhotoView Много рабочих библиотек уже создано и легко гуглится
Akb
Здароу! В чем может быть причина, что LiveData.observe() триггерится, но с пустыми данными? Хотя перед самой отправкой setValue и postValue есть проверка на isEmpty
Андрей
Ты магистра Йоду не признал что ли?)
Michael
Народ, а почему Optional в методе orElseThrow выбрасывает throwable? То есть я не могу сделать что-то вроде Optional.of(12).orElseThrow(RuntimeException::new) в какоим-то методе, не добавив в его сигнатуру throws Throwable? Гуглил проблему: некоторые говорят, что баг jdk, но у меня новый достаточно: openjdk version "1.8.0_152-release"
Lev
Сейчас же последняя 11.0.1
Michael
Да, ошибся) но люди пишут что у них такое работает норм
Michael
На 8 версии
Michael
Просто неужели никто не использует/не сталкивался с этим методом? Я понимаю, что Optional достаточно неоднозначный, но все же
Max
У кого-то стояло приложение fabric на телефоне? С последним обновлением тупо не могу залогиниться Его что вырубили?
Виктор
Да. В связи с переездом на Firebase